News: Person hospitalized following hit-and-run crash on William Cannon Dr

AUSTIN, TX – One person was hospitalized following a hit-and-run accident on William Cannon Drive in South Austin this afternoon, according to Austin-Travis County EMS.

The crash occurred at 744 W William Cannon Dr, near S 1st Street, at 3:30 p.m., when two vehicles collided. The occupants of one of those vehicles then fled the scene.

One person was entrapped within the wreckage for a short time. By 3:46 p.m., they had been rescued from the crash.

The victim was declared a trauma alert, and then was taken to Dell Seton to receive treatment for possibly serious wounds.

Drivers were told to expect traffic delays near the scene and were asked to avoid the area.
